Avant Browser has...
... a number of mouse gestures available. You'll also find a number of other features, too many for my taste, but worth reading.

There's a program called Mouse Gestures, but it's open source using java, so I don't have much hope for it.

If you go into advanced search on softpedia.com and ask for freeware mouse gestures in the description you will receive 641 hits. Some of those do not appear to be very relevant, or they may not be what you're looking for. You probably won't find more than 20 that do exactly what you want, and some will probably work better than others.

That's why arecommendations are a major time saver.

Anyway, doesn't take too much looking.
